The term "drift" applies to the Joycons. It occurs when the Joycons move on your screen without you actually touching them. The best option is to take them to your local Geek Squad, or request a repair ticket from the official Nintendo website. Trying to repair them yourself is also and option, but may render the Joycons useless and may void your warranty. Hope this helps!
